The Phoenix Contact PCB header from the IPCV 5/7-GF series is designed for seamless integration into various connection technologies, enhancing device versatility. With a robust design and green insulating material, this product stands out for its reliability and performance in demanding electrical environments. Its inverted configuration ensures touch-proof connections, making it ideal for both PCB-to-PCB and device outputs. Engineered for easy wave soldering, it accommodates a variety of applications while providing superior mechanical stability thanks to its screw locking mechanism. This header allows for significant design flexibility, making it a trusted choice for engineers seeking dependable connectivity solutions.

Inverted design supports touch-proof outputs

Screw locking mechanism enhances mechanical stability

Configured for wave soldering, simplifying assembly

Compatible with multiple connection technologies, offering versatility

Engineered for high current loads, ensuring reliable performance

Green colour coding facilitates easy identification in assemblies

Integrated double steel spring provides added safety against fluctuations
